Ajax是一种常用的技术,它可以让网页实现无刷新的交互体验。通常我们需要通过Ajax从数据库中获取数据,常见的数据库格式有JSON、XML等。本篇文章将介绍如何使用Ajax从服务器上拿取JSON数据。
function loadData() { var request = new XMLHttpRequest(); request.open('GET','data.json',true); request.onload = function() { if (request.status >= 200 && request.status这个函数使用的是原生的JavaScript代码。我们首先创建一个XMLHttpRequest对象,用于发出请求。然后使用open函数打开一个GET请求,并且指定URL。在请求成功时,我们使用JSON.parse函数将返回的JSON数据转换成对象,并且在控制台上输出数据。在请求错误时,我们会在控制台上输出错误信息。
<button onclick="loadData()">请求数据</button>这个按钮的点击事件会触发loadData函数,从而发出请求并且获取数据。
总结来说,使用Ajax从JSON数据库中获取数据可以通过定义一个请求数据的函数以及在HTML中调用这个函数来实现。请求成功时,我们可以使用JSON.parse函数将返回的JSON数据转变成对象并使用JavaScript操作。这种技术非常实用,可以让页面拥有更好的用户体验。
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。